Aluminum Cans & Foil

Preparation: Rinse.
Acceptable: Aluminum cans and foil, TV dinner trays, pie pans.
Unacceptable: No steel. If unsure, test with (refrigerator) magnet which sticks to steel and not to aluminum.
Fee: None
Recycling Centers:
All Transfer Sites and Glenwood

Appliances

Acceptable as scrap metal - no fee: stoves, water heaters, toasters and other small appliances without motors.
Acceptable as scrap metal if motors are removed: washers, dryers, dishwashers.

Accepted for fee only - no exceptions: refrigerators, freezers, air conditioners and other appliances having compressors/freon, whether or not freon has been removed. Also washers and dryers with motors still attached.

Household Batteries

Preparation: Separate by type. Handle with care, acid will burn bare skin.
Acceptable: Nickel-cadmium, mercury, lithium, lead acid car batteries.
Unacceptable: Alkaline batteries sold in Oregon after 1996. Throw theses away as trash.  (
Alkaline batteries sold before 1996, or those that may contain mercury, are acceptable in this collection program.)
Fee: None
Recycling Centers:
All Transfer Sites and Glenwood

Cardboard & Brown Paper Bags

Preparation: Flatten all items.
Acceptable: All corrugated cardboard (three-ply with visible wavy layer inside) and brown  paper shopping bags.
Unacceptable: No waxed boxes, no
cereal boxes or other box board that does not have the three ply.
Fee: None
Recycling Centers:
All Transfer Sites and Glenwood

Glass Bottles and Jars

Preparation: Rinse, don't break, separate by color.
Acceptable: Brown, green, and clear. Labels are OK, put metal lids with tin cans.
Unacceptable: Pyrex dishes, drinking glasses, light bulbs, window or mirror glass.
Fee: None
Recycling Centers:
All Transfer Sites and Glenwood

Motor Oil and Oil Filters

Preparation: Pour motor oil into an unbreakable container with a tight lid. Empty your container into recycling drum.   Place oil filters in oil filter drum.
Acceptable: Any type of motor oil including transmission and hydraulic fluids.
Unacceptable: No antifreeze, No brake fluid, solvents, or gasoline.
Fee: None
Recycling Centers:
All Transfer Sites and Glenwood accept oil.     Oil Filters are accepted at All Transfer sites except McKenzi Bridge.

Plastics

Preparation: Rinse containers, remove and discard lids . Separate milk jugs, no lids.
Acceptable: ONLY  bottles, tubs and jar shapes, codes #1 through #5 and #7. Separate milk jugs.
Unacceptable: No shape other than a bottle or tub, No block foam, packing peanuts, No plastic bags, No Tupperware/Rubbermaid items. No #6 polystyrene.
Fee: None
Recycling Centers:
All Transfer Sites and Glenwood

Plastic Bags and Film

Preparation: Rinse, or turn inside out and shake vigorously.
Acceptable: all bags from grocery, retail, or numbered with #2 or #4                                                  
 
Unacceptable: No ziplock bags, no celophane or other wrappers, plastic bags,  No food or dirt contamination.
Fee:
None
Recycling Centers:
Glenwood  Central Receiving Station,  Cottage Grove, Cresswell, Florence, Mapleton, McKenzi Bridge Oakridge and Veneta

Tires

Preparation: There is an additional fee if the rim is still in the tire.  We suggest the rim be removed and recycled separately as scrap metal.
Acceptable:  Passenger tires only.

Unacceptable: Tires larger than 30"rimdiameter.
Fee:
Yes    Less than 17" $2,   17"-24"  $6,   24"-30"  $20
Recycling Centers:
All Transfer Sites and Glenwood

Wood Waste

Preparation: Remove hardware larger than your thumb                                                                            Acceptable: Just about any solid wood: Dimensional lumber, plywood,  press board, peg board, lathing, pallets, paneling and furniture ( wood only,  no hardware larger than screws, bolts. Painted ok.)
Unacceptable: No Creasote treated (railroad ties), No foam core or any plastic, No formica, No hardware fittings larger than your thumb.                                                                                                
 
                                                                   Fee: Yes
Recycling Centers:  Glenwood Central Recycling Station , Cottage Grove and Florence
